New AI Trick Shrinks Image Files 10% Without Losing Quality

Your photos and videos could load faster and eat less data.

Deep Dive

A team of researchers has unveiled a new way to shrink digital images without hurting how they look. Their system, called MIRC, uses artificial intelligence to squeeze photos and video frames into smaller files. In tests, it produced files roughly 10% smaller than VVC — one of the most efficient compression standards used today — while keeping the same image quality.

Traditional compression works by spotting repetitive patterns and removing redundant data. MIRC goes further by tailoring itself to each individual image. It studies the picture, learns its details, and then builds a custom compression recipe just for that file. This "overfitted" approach has been tried before, but earlier versions were slow and inefficient. MIRC fixes that by doing all the heavy lifting upfront, then decompressing very quickly.

Why does this matter to you? Smaller image files mean web pages load faster, video calls use less bandwidth, and your phone's storage lasts longer. Streaming services could deliver higher quality video without using more data. Apps, photo backups, and cloud services would also become cheaper to run — savings that might eventually reach your monthly bill.

The catch: the compression step takes extra computing power compared to standard tools. That's fine for pre-recorded videos or photos uploaded to the cloud, but it's not yet practical for live video chats on a cheap phone. Still, the team says the decoding side is light enough for many devices, and they've made configurations that let manufacturers choose their preferred balance between speed and file size.
